Transaction 43dc85c2c8bbf33f62b39f676ce1d2dc269103964ccc13b6b01920002220315b

1 Input
2 Outputs
  • 43dc85c2c8bbf33f62b39f676ce1d2dc269103964ccc13b6b01920002220315b:0
  • value  16771318
    address  34BX9PpNFzbLKDE6t4DvCMAKRjbtuL2pKN
  • 43dc85c2c8bbf33f62b39f676ce1d2dc269103964ccc13b6b01920002220315b:1
  • value  400000
    address  1NN6DpP616DuGyo5Ktiii8SrN2wPejV1Y9